Determination of major human cytochrome P450s activities in 96-well plates using liquid chromatography tandem mass spectrometry.

2007

At the early stage of drug discovery, thousands of new chemical entities (NCEs) may be screened before a single candidate can be identified for development. Evaluation of the effect of NCEs on human CYP450 enzyme activities is a key issue in pharmaceutical development as it may explain inter-subject variability, drug-drug interactions, non-linear pharmacokinetics and toxic effects. A liquid chromatography tandem mass spectrometry (HPLC-MS/MS) method has been developed for the fast and routine analysis of major human CYP450s enzyme activities (CYP1A2, CYP2A6, CYP2B6, CYP2C9, CYP2C19, CYP2D6, CYP2E1 and CYP3A4) in primary hepatocyte cell cultures. Coherence resonance in Bonhoeffer-Van der Pol circuit

2009

International audience; A nonlinear electronic circuit simulating the neuronal activity in a noisy environment is proposed. This electronic circuit is exactly ruled by the set of Bonhoeffer-Van Der Pol equations and is excited with a Gaussian noise. Without external deterministic stimuli, it is shown that the circuit exhibits the so-called 'coherence resonance' phenomenon.
